What is ADEX?
The ADEX Click Fraud Detection Software enables advertisers, agencies and networks to eliminate fraudulent traffic before it reaches the pay-per-click campaigns. This is done by identifying pay-per-click bots" that are designed to click on ads via set parameters. It then creates a block list that is sent back to Google Analytics to help prevent advertisers from paying for invalid clicks from bots.."
